Index: src/libchcore/TSubTaskScanDirectory.h =================================================================== diff -u -N -ra44714d5c7ec0f50a376f4d0ea919ee5a224f834 -rd76d3ce6c8c55fa23009dbb03b8bc06f482c5b72 --- src/libchcore/TSubTaskScanDirectory.h (.../TSubTaskScanDirectory.h) (revision a44714d5c7ec0f50a376f4d0ea919ee5a224f834) +++ src/libchcore/TSubTaskScanDirectory.h (.../TSubTaskScanDirectory.h) (revision d76d3ce6c8c55fa23009dbb03b8bc06f482c5b72) @@ -33,29 +33,6 @@ class TFileFiltersArray; -namespace details -{ - /////////////////////////////////////////////////////////////////////////// - // TScanDirectoriesProgressInfo - - class TScanDirectoriesProgressInfo : public TSubTaskProgressInfo - { - public: - TScanDirectoriesProgressInfo(); - virtual ~TScanDirectoriesProgressInfo(); - - virtual void ResetProgress(); - - void SetCurrentIndex(file_count_t fcIndex); - void IncreaseCurrentIndex(); - file_count_t GetCurrentIndex() const; - - private: - file_count_t m_fcCurrentIndex; - mutable boost::shared_mutex m_lock; - }; -} - /////////////////////////////////////////////////////////////////////////// // TSubTaskScanDirectories @@ -73,7 +50,6 @@ virtual void Store(const ISerializerPtr& spSerializer) const; virtual void Load(const ISerializerPtr& spSerializer); - virtual TSubTaskProgressInfo& GetProgressInfo() { return m_tProgressInfo; } virtual void GetStatsSnapshot(TSubTaskStatsSnapshotPtr& spStats) const; private: @@ -83,7 +59,6 @@ private: #pragma warning(push) #pragma warning(disable: 4251) - details::TScanDirectoriesProgressInfo m_tProgressInfo; TSubTaskStatsInfo m_tSubTaskStats; #pragma warning(pop) };